12 May 2011, 7:11 am
In a ruling by the Third Circuit Court of Appeal for the State of Louisiana, the Louisiana Department of Wildlife and Fisheries (LDWF) and the Department of Transportation and Development (DOTD) were found jointly liable for $3.9 million to Vanna McManus and her children, the survivors of a man who drowned at Chivery Dam in Natchitoches Parish. 10 Sep 2014, 2:21 pm by Sutherland LNG
Department of Energy (DOE) has authorized Louisiana LNG Energy to export via vessel over a 25-year period 2 million metric tonnes per annum (103.4 Bcf) from a proposed LNG terminal in Plaquemines Parish, La. to nations with a Free Trade Agreement (FTA) with the United States. [read post]
